
How to crochet Big apple amigurumi pattern

Abbreviations:
R= round
mr = magic ring
sc = single crochet
inc = increase (2 sc in the next stitch)
W = 3 sc in the next stitch
dec = decrease (join the next 2 stitches into 1)
sl st = slip stitch
st = stitch
ch = chain
dc = double crochet
tr = treble crochet
hdc = half double crochet
F.O = finish off
BLO = back loop only
FLO = front loop only
[ ] = number of stitches you should have at the end of the round/row
( ) x 6 = repeat whatever is between the brackets the number of times stated
To crochet a big apple amigurumi, you need:
– Yarn: green, brown, red
– Crochet hook
– Fiberfill for stuffing
– Sewing needle and scissors

Apple
Start with red yarn
| R 1: 8 sc in mr | [8] |
| R 2: (1 sc, inc) x 4 | [12] |
| R 3: 12 sc | [12] |
| R 4: (1 sc, inc) x 6 | [18] |
| R 5: (2 sc, inc) x 6 | [24] |
| R 6: (3 sc, inc) x 6 | [30] |
| R 7: (4 sc, inc) x 6 | [36] |
| R 8: (5 sc, inc) x 6 | [42] |
| R 9: (6 sc, inc) x 6 | [48] |
| R 10: (7 sc, inc) x 6 | [54] |
| R 11: (8 sc, inc) x 6 | [60] |
| R 12-16: 60 sc (5 rounds) | [60] |
| R 17: (8 sc, dec) x 6 | [54] |
| R 18-20: 54 s (3 rounds) | [54] |
| R 21: (7 sc, dec) x 6 | [48] |
| R 22-23: 48 sc (2 rounds) | [48] |
| R 24: (6 sc, dec) x 6 | [42] |
| R 25: 42 sc | [42] |
| R 26: (5 sc, dec) x 6 | 36] |
| R 27: (4 sc, dec) x 6 | [30] |
| R 28: (3 sc, dec) x 6 | [24] |
| R 29: (2 sc, dec) x 6 | [18] |
| R 30: (1 sc, dec) x 6 | [12] |
| Stuff with fiberfill | |
| R 31: 12 sc | [12] |
| R 32: dec x 6 | [6] |
FO. Stuff with fiberfill. Cut the yarn, leaving a long tail for sewing.

Stem
Start with brown yarn
Slip knot, 10 Ch.
R 1: sc in second chain from hook, sc in next 10 stitches.
FO. Cut the yarn, leaving a long tail for sewing.
Leaf
Start with green yarn
Crochet 7 chain. Continue working around the foundation chain
R 1: In the next stitch, beginning from the 2nd st from your hook, crochet (1 sc, 1 hdc, 2 dc, 1 hdc, 1 sc). Continue crocheting the other side of the foundation chain (1 sc, 1 hdc, 2 dc, 1 hdc, 1 sc).
FO. Stuff with fiberfill. Cut the yarn, leaving a long tail for sewing.

Assembly:
- Attach the stem and leaf to the apple
- Sew with a tapestry needle to close up the bottom opening of the apple.
- Insert the needle from the center bottom to the top. Insert the needle back into the apple from the top center, but not in the same place where it came out, to the bottom. Pull to create an indentation at the top and bottom center of the apple.
- Knit the yarn. Hide the knot and yarn inside the apple.
